Latest fashion news from Paris lays emphasis on the richness of materials used to add glamor to gowns for grand occasions. Satin, faille, tulle and lace are used lavishly for evening gowns, while formal afternoon dresses tire mostly of taffetas, faille, or Ottoman silk. The most fashionable colors are still the muted shades--slate and pastel-blue, soft primrose, rose. ... [ILLUSTRATED]
